Understanding KYC and AML Regulations
Know Your Customer (KYC) regulations are a set of guidelines designed to prevent identity theft, fraud, and financial crime. They require casinos to verify the identity of their customers and assess the risk associated with their accounts.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ations, on the other hand, focus on preventing criminals from using casinos to launder illicit funds. These two sets of regulations work in tandem to create a secure and transparent gaming environment. Failing to comply with KYC and AML regulations can result in hefty fines and even the revocation of a casino’s license.
The specific requirements of KYC and AML regulations vary depending on the jurisdiction. However, common elements include verifying the identity of customers, monitoring transactions for suspicious activity, and reporting any suspected money laundering to the relevant authorities. Effective KYC and AML programs are essential for maintaining the integrity of the online gambling industry.
The Verification Process: What to Expect
The identity verification process typically begins when a player attempts to make a deposit or withdrawal. The casino will request documentation to verify the player’s identity, such as a copy of their driver’s license or passport, a utility bill to confirm their address, and potentially, proof of ownership of any deposit methods used. The process may also involve a “selfie” with identification for added security measures. It’s essential to provide accurate and legible documentation to avoid delays in the verification process. verify Winnerz identity often utilizes automated systems to accelerate this process, but human review may still be necessary in certain cases.
Casinos employ various technologies to verify the authenticity of submitted documents. These include image recognition software, document validation tools, and database checks. The goal is to ensure that the documents are genuine and haven’t been tampered with. Once the verification process is complete, the player will be notified, and they can continue to enjoy the casino’s games and services.

AI and Machine Learning in Fraud Detection
Art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) are transforming the way casinos detect and prevent fraud. These technologies analyze vast amounts of data to identify patterns and anomalies that may indicate fraudulent activity. ML algorithms can learn from past fraud cases and adapt to new threats over time. AI-powered fraud detection systems can identify suspicious transactions, flag potentially fraudulent accounts, and even predict future fraud attempts.
For example, AI can analyze a player’s betting patterns, deposit history, and geographical location to identify unusual activity. It can also detect instances of collusion between players or the use of bots. By leveraging the power of AI and ML, casinos can stay one step ahead of fraudsters and protect their players.
